A '''limited power of attorney''' ends when the job it describes is done, or on the date it specifies. For example, if you gave your attorney power to sell a piece of property, the power of attorney ends when the property is sold. | |||
A '''general power of attorney''' automatically ends in each of these circumstances: | A '''general power of attorney''' automatically ends in each of these circumstances: |
